    Hoffenheim is one of the original "plastic" teams, now owned by a former player, Hopp, a software guy, who took his village side to the Bundesliga. In Germany, they call it "Hopp"enheim. It's close to Heidelberg, near the Sinsheim Technical Museum (worth a visit--and you can see the stadium from the museum) and the Hockenheim GP racetrack.
